03 / Diagnosis

Where the opportunity sat.

Manual handoffs and fragmented information create repeat work. The design maps inputs, review points, ownership and outputs before choosing automation steps.

04 / The thinking

Build around the connection.

Map the data sources, standardise metric definitions and automate recurring preparation while retaining human review for commercial interpretation.

08 / Looking ahead

Lessons & next opportunity.

Automate stable, repeatable preparation first; preserve a review step for ambiguous data and commercial decisions.

Next opportunity: log completion time and exception frequency to quantify the operational change.
